Grand River Dam Authority · Oklahoma
State utility · EIA utility no. 7490
In 2024, Grand River Dam Authority's Oklahoma customers averaged 0.8 outages and 30 minutes without power. These are Grand River Dam Authority's own filings to EIA, under the Other reliability standard, including major storm days.

Outage history
Minutes without power per customer · storm days shown separately
| Year | With storm days | Without storm days | Outages / yr | Relative duration |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2024 | 30 | 30 | 0.8 | |
| 2023 | 135 | 135 | 0.3 | |
| 2022 | 79 | 79 | 1.3 | |
| 2021 | 57 | 57 | 0.7 | |
| 2020 | 10 | 10 | 0.3 | |
| 2019 | 77 | 77 | 0.7 | |
| 2018 | 53 | 53 | 0.9 |

Self-reported
Utilities report these figures to EIA themselves; EIA does not audit every submission, and outages from recent months appear only in the next annual release. Major storm days
